Mrs. Estella D. Crawford, 90, died Thursday after an illness of eight years.

A Peoria resident for 85 years, Mrs. Crawford was born at La-Harpe June 2, 1874. She was a daughter of Henry and Isabel Barr Bidault, and was married to Walter E. Crawford in Peoria Jan. 25, 1894. He died here Sept. 1, 1915. She formerly was a matron at the Madison and Palace theaters for 34 years.

Surviving are one daughter, Mrs. Richard (Dorothy) Adami of Washburn; and two sisters, Mrs. Frances Herzberg of Home Speech, Fla., and Mrs. Charles (Winifred) Wilday of Rome.

Full obit in the Peoria Journal Star, Sun., April 4, 1965, a.m. edition, page D-6.
